Cost estimates from building contractors may be pivotal in figuring out project feasibility and guaranteeing finances compliance. Understanding what to anticipate during this process can empower both homeowners and developers.


Typically, preliminary cost estimates will encompass varied elements, including labor, materials, gear, and overhead. Each of those elements plays an important role in the general price range. For instance, materials costs fluctuate based mostly on high quality and availability, so contractors must stay up to date with current market charges.

Labor prices are one other significant component. The ability stage of the workforce, native wage requirements, and project timelines can considerably influence these estimates. Competent contractors usually assess earlier initiatives and labor availability, ensuring their estimates stay competitive yet practical.


Overhead costs usually embody insurance, licensing, and bond necessities that contractors should fulfill. These fastened expenses could appear minor but can accumulate, affecting the bottom line. However, a reliable contractor will transparently talk these costs to their clients, making certain there are not any surprises later.

An essential think about receiving accurate estimates is the scope of labor. A detailed description helps contractors make informed assessments. Vague project descriptions can lead to fluctuating prices, as contractors might uncover hidden challenges as soon as the project starts. The more clarity supplied upfront, the extra exact the estimate will doubtless be.

In addition to materials and labor issues, the situation of the project can greatly impression prices. Geographic variables, like regional pricing and logistical considerations, can have an effect on accessibility to material suppliers and labor markets. Costs are usually greater in city areas compared to rural areas, which is an important consideration during the budgeting phase.


Once the contractor develops a preliminary estimate, it often undergoes iterative revisions. Feedback from purchasers might result in changes primarily based on preferences or budget constraints. This back-and-forth can refine the project's scope, resulting in a last estimate that aligns carefully with the shopper's imaginative and prescient and monetary means.




Estimating tools and software are more and more utilized by contractors to enhance accuracy. These platforms can help in calculating project prices with higher effectivity by automating elements of the estimation process. However, while these instruments are useful, human oversight is crucial to account for the nuances that software program might overlook.

Contingency plans additionally play a major function in constructing value estimates. A contingency fund, typically a percentage of the total costs, accounts for surprising adjustments. Variables such as climate delays, material price hikes, or labor shortages can impact timelines and budgets considerably. Including contingencies inside the estimate demonstrates a contractor's foresight and thorough method.


It’s additionally advisable to request detailed breakdowns when reviewing estimates. A complete view of individual price components can make clear the place expenses arise. Clients ought to search for not simply the total projected value, however perception into how each element contributes to that figure.

What is the difference between a quote and a value estimate?


A quote is usually a exhausting and fast price for the work specified, while a value estimate offers an approximation that may regulate because the project progresses. Understanding this difference is crucial for budgeting and planning.
